Finding the Right Program: Not All Paths Are Created Equal


Surgical tech certification programs come in various shapes and sizes. Here's a breakdown to help you navigate your options:

Associate's Degree Programs: These two-year programs offer a comprehensive curriculum, combining classroom learning with extensive clinical rotations. They provide a strong foundation in surgical procedures, aseptic technique, pharmacology, and patient care.

Certificate Programs: These quicker, more focused programs typically take one year to complete. They delve into core surgical technology concepts but may offer less in-depth coursework compared to associate's degrees.

Choosing Your Training Ground: Accreditation Matters

Accreditation is a fancy term for a program meeting specific educational standards set by a national organization. Here's why it matters:

Quality Assurance: Accredited programs ensure you receive high-quality education that meets industry expectations.
Eligibility for Certification: To become a Certified Surgical Technologist (CST), you need to graduate from an accredited program.
Employer Recognition: Many hospitals and surgical centers prefer candidates who graduated from accredited programs.

Beyond the Classroom: Honing Your Surgical Skills

Surgical tech programs go beyond textbooks. Expect to spend significant time in simulation labs, where you'll practice suturing techniques, instrument handling, and sterile draping under the guidance of experienced instructors. The crown jewel is the clinical externship, where you'll put your newfound knowledge to the test in real operating rooms alongside practicing surgeons and surgical techs.
